A rewarding contract opportunity awaits for a skilled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) with CCC, ready to make an impact in an educational setting near Kennesaw, GA. This full-time position focuses on supporting elementary and middle school students at a single school site for the upcoming academic year, running from August 4, 2026, through May 26, 2027. While the specific caseload details are still being finalized, you will collaborate with a dedicated team, fostering communication development and student success.

What Were Looking For:

  • Masters degree in Speech-Language Pathology from an accredited program
  • Active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C) from ASHA
  • Current and valid GA PSC educator certification (required for school-based SLPs)
  • Professional state licensure as an SLP in Georgia
  • Proven school-based experience supporting diverse student needs
  • Ability to complete and pass fingerprinting and drug screening requirements
  • Strong communication and documentation skills
  • Enthusiasm for collaborating within a dynamic school environment

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ide direct speech-language therapy services to students in elementary and middle school settings
  • Assess, diagnose, and treat a broad range of communication disorders
  • Collaborate with teachers, administrators, and families on IEPs and intervention plans
  • Maintain accurate, timely student records and documentation
  • Participate in multidisciplinary team meetings and contribute expertise to help students thrive
